Leaf, stem and root anatomy of Consolida thirkeana (Boiss.) Bornm. (Ranunculaceae)

1Department of Pharmaceutical Botany, Faculty of Pharmacy, Ankara University, Yenimahalle 06560 Ankara, Turkey DOI : 10.29228/jrp.32 Consolida thirkeana (Boiss.) Bornm. (Ranunculaceae) is endemic to Turkey and described by laciniae linear leaves, pale lilac flowers, sessile follicles and called as “boz mahmuz”. Plant material was collected from Ayaş (Ankara-Turkey). The transverse sections of leaf, stem and root were examined anatomically in this study. The leaf is monofacial and has a 1-layer epidermis. Ranunculaceous stomata and unicellular non-glandular hairs were observed in the epidermis. The stem is characterized by a 1-layer of epidermis, glandular and non-glandular hairs. Cortex parenchyma contains dense starch. Pericyclic sclerenchymatous ring and concave xylem are observed. The root has periderm, pericyclic sclerenchymatous ring and vessels embedded in sclerenchymatous pith cells. Keywords : Consolida thirkeana; Ranunculaceae; leaf; stem; root; plant anatomy; Turkey
